Python裡面的負號的各種神奇用法?來填坑啦

2022-07-21 04:21:11 字數 430 閱讀 8551

1.x.reshape(-1,2)

x = np.linspace(1,10,10)

x.reshape(-1,2)

reshape(-1,2)裡-1的應該是不管多少行,按兩列算,行數自動算出。同理,reshape(2,-1)會自動算出列數。如果不能整除給出的那個正數的話就會報錯。負數等同於-1

這裡的負號有自動的意思。

2.l[-1]

l = np.arange(10)

l[-1]#取最後乙個元素

l[-2]#取倒數第二個元素

l[:-2]#從前取到倒數第二個元素,不包含

l = np.arange(10,1,-1)

這裡的負號有倒數的意思。

3.x, y = np.split(data, (-1, ), axis=1)

這裡的意思是資料的第一維度n-1

wp模板裡面的各種判斷

is single 判斷是否是具體文章的頁面 is single 2 判斷是否是具體文章 id 2 的頁面 is single beef stew 判斷是否是具體文章 標題判斷 的頁面 is single beef stew 判斷是否是具體文章 slug判斷 的頁面 comments open pi...

Python裡面的字典

python 將這種資料型別叫做 dict 有的語言裡它的名稱是 hash 這兩種名字都會用到,不過這並不重要,重要的是它們和列表的區別。你看,針對列表你可以做這樣的事情 things a b c d print things 1 b things 1 z print things 1 z prin...

python裡面的數學

一.基本運算子 1.算數運算 2.比較運算 特殊情況 不等於 新版本不支援 不等號 3.賦值運算 4.邏輯運算 not 非 非真即假,非假即真.and 並且 左右兩端同時為真,結果才為真.or 或者 左右兩端有乙個為真,結果就是真.true 真 1 判斷的結果 false 假 0 判斷的結果 pri...